Noreen C. Barnes, Ph.D., is director of graduate studies for the Department of Theatre and an adjunct faculty member for the doctoral program of the Union Institute. A theatre historian, Barnes’ specialties include nineteenth-century American and British theater, contemporary political theater and the history of gender in performance.

Barnes is the former editor of “Theatre Symposium,” a publication of the Southeastern Theatre Conference, and has published essays and reviews in numerous journals and anthologies. She is also a director and dramaturg and has worked with such artists as director Joseph Chaikin and writer/performer Kate Bornstein.

Barnes received her Ph.D. from Tufts University.
